Causes of the PS058 QuickBooks Error
Like any other mistake, QuickBooks payroll error PS058 develops for a variety of causes. We will discuss the problem’s cause in this part so that you, as users, can exercise caution and possibly even successfully resolve the mistake.
- One of the main causes of error code PS058 is damaged or corrupted QuickBooks company files.
- The Windows component files contain several internal problems.
- The QuickBooks company data file is not stored by default on the C: Drive.
- The update procedure is being hampered by the Windows Firewall or an anti-virus program that is installed on the computer, leading to error PS058.
- Your Payroll subscription is no longer active.
- Inaccurate Employee Identification Number (EIN) in corporate file

Review the Payroll Service Subscription in Step 1
You can use this initial step to see if your payroll subscription is still in effect. The QuickBooks payroll problem PS058 is caused by an inactive subscription, so you must check it following the procedures below.
- Close QuickBooks and the company files first.
- Restart the system shortly after.
- Open QuickBooks, then select Employees.
- Choose Manage Service Key after choosing My Payroll Service.
- Examine the Service Name and Status choices, which both need to be set to Active.
- To verify your service key number, click Edit. If the key appears to be incorrect, make the necessary adjustments and click Next.
- Open Payroll Setup should be unchecked.
- Select Finish.
- After the aforementioned information has been changed, the payroll update should start downloading.
Continue to the next step if the QuickBooks payroll error PS058 persists.
Step 2: Download the most recent updates for QuickBooks.
Various error codes are frequent when your version of QuickBooks is outdated. Therefore, to address payroll problems, our specialists advise updating QuickBooks.
- First, close the QuickBooks Desktop application and any opened company files.
- Next, select Start from the menu and then search for QuickBooks Desktop.
- Find the icon and then select Run as administrator from the context menu.
- The No Company Open screen is reached by this command.
- Choose Help from the menu.
- Select QuickBooks Desktop Update.
- Now select Mark All from the Options menu.
- Decide whether to save.
- Select the Reset Update checkbox after selecting the Update Now tab.
- Utilize the Get Updates button to finish the procedure.
You have to shut down and restart QuickBooks Desktop. Click the Yes button on your screen to apply the updates and restart your computer.
Run Quick Fix my Program in step three.
Under QB Tool Hub, there is an option called Quick Fix my software. This is an additional step you can do to address QuickBooks Payroll Error PS058 since Program Hub is an external tool that enables users to manage common QuickBooks errors.
- Close QuickBooks if the data file is still open.
- To access the QuickBooks Tool Hub, open a web browser now.
- The download file will need to be saved somewhere on your computer, and you will be prompted to do so. We advise picking a location that is simple to get to.
- When the file is on your computer, double-click it to install the Tool hub and follow the on-screen instructions to finish the procedure.
- You must also concur with the terms and conditions.
- Double-clicking the QuickBooks Tool Hub icon is the next step.
- Select Program Problems from the list of options once you are on the QuickBooks Tools Hub.
- Go to Quick Fix My Program and click.
Check the most recent tax table to verify if the payroll update may proceed without issues.
